
Salto de Rosado is a roadside waterfall in Paraguay where mist, colored rock, and plunging water create strong nature-and-waterscape compositions. Best light comes mid-morning to late afternoon (softer highlights on spray); weekdays reduce crowding. Access is by car to the Potrero area—carry water, wear grippy shoes, and expect uneven paths; no special entry permits typically, but check local conditions on arrival.
